Good copy doesn’t win by sounding smart. It wins by being easy to read and impossible to ignore. The secret? The 4 C’s: Clear, Concise, Compelling, and Credible.
The Formula That Converts
Clear copy keeps readers from guessing. Concise lines respect their time. Compelling ideas make them care. And credibility seals the deal with proof.
Why It Works
- Readers understand instantly (less friction).
- Every word earns its keep (no fluff).
- Emotional pull drives action (desire beats logic).
- Proof builds trust (no empty promises).
Real-World Proof
- Apple keeps product copy tight and believable.
- Basecamp shows real user quotes instead of jargon.
- Dollar Shave Club wins with one razor-sharp promise.
- Mailchimp mixes friendly tone with solid case studies.
